These 15x452mm sanding belts fit M10 sander adapters and similar polishing machines. The multi-grit pack uses aluminum oxide grain. It works on wood, metal, and plastic. This 15x452mm sanding belt assortment handles many different jobs. Features and Benefits
- Grit Range from 60 to 600 - This covers rough stock removal up to fine polishing.
- Aluminum Oxide Abrasive - It cuts consistently on wood and most common metals, including stainless steel.
- Cloth Backing - This backing resists tearing and stays flexible. It works well even on curved surfaces.
- Strong Tape Joint - The joint runs smoothly over the workpiece. This helps create an even finish. Applications
- Woodworking - Use coarse grits to shape wood or strip old finishes. Finer grits prepare surfaces for stain.
- Metal Fabrication - It is good for deburring cut edges. It also cleans up welds or puts a satin finish on steel.
- Plastic and Composites - This smooths 3D printed parts. It also finishes the edges of cut acrylic sheets.

Method 1: Handheld Belt Sander (Sanding Belt)
To use a sanding belt with an M10 Sander Adapter Polishing Machine, first ensure the machine is unplugged or the battery removed. Securely attach the 15x452mm belt to the M10 adapter, following the adapter's specific instructions for belt installation. Select the appropriate grit for your task; 60 grit for aggressive material removal, 120 grit for general sanding, and 400 or 600 grit for fine finishing. Hold the M10 adapter firmly and apply even pressure, moving the sanding surface smoothly across the material. Avoid excessive pressure, which can damage the belt or the workpiece.
Method 2: Replacing an Internal Drive Belt (Handheld or Stationary)
Replacing an internal drive belt on a belt sander, such as a Craftsman model, is a different procedure from changing the sanding belt. It involves disassembling part of the sander to access the motor and drive mechanism. This task is specific to the sander's make and model. Our 15x452mm belts are sanding belts for material removal, not internal drive belts. Always refer to your sander's user manual for instructions on replacing internal components. Incorrectly replacing a drive belt can lead to poor performance or damage to the tool.
